Prep⁢ and Cook​ Time

  • Readiness: 15⁤ minutes
  • Cooking: 30 minutes
  • Total Time: 45 minutes

Yield

Serves 4 hearty portions

Difficulty Level

Easy -‌ Ideal⁣ for home ​cooks looking to elevate ​weeknight meals with ​nutritious ingredients and ‌fresh flavors.

Ingredients that Elevate Flavor and​ Nutrition

  • 1 lb (450g) ground turkey ​- ⁣lean and packed with protein,essential for a light yet⁢ satisfying sauce
  • 2 medium zucchinis,spiralized ‍or‍ thinly sliced into ribbons – adds ‍moisture​ and ⁢subtle sweetness,replacing traditional pasta carbs
  • 1 large onion,finely chopped – builds ⁣a deep flavor base
  • 3 ⁤cloves garlic,minced – brightens the dish with pungent warmth
  • 1 can ⁣(14 oz) crushed tomatoes ⁤- lends ⁤rich acidity and color
  • 2 tbsp tomato paste – ⁣intensifies the tomato depth for ⁢a luscious sauce
  • 1 medium carrot,finely diced ⁣- natural sweetness and texture variation
  • 1 celery stalk,finely ‌diced – ​classic aromatic ‍for complexity
  • 2 tbsp extra virgin ‍olive oil – ‌healthy ‌fat for sautéing
  • 1 tsp dried oregano and 1 tsp dried basil – foundational ⁣herbs to evoke Italian authenticity
  • Fresh basil leaves,torn (about ¼ cup) – added‌ at the end⁣ for vibrant flavor and freshness
  • Red pepper flakes,optional,to taste ⁣- adds a subtle heat kick
  • Salt and freshly ground black pepper,to taste
  • ½ cup ‌low-sodium chicken or​ vegetable broth – helps meld flavors while⁣ keeping sauce ​moist
  • Parmesan cheese,freshly grated,for serving (optional)

Step by Step ⁤Guide ⁣to Perfectly Cooking Turkey and Zucchini for Optimal ⁣Texture

  1. heat 1 tbsp​ olive ⁣oil ​in a large non-stick ⁢skillet ​over medium-high heat.Add ⁢the ‍chopped onions, carrot, and celery. ⁢Sauté until ‍softened ⁢and fragrant,about 5 ⁣minutes,stirring occasionally.
  2. Stir in ⁣minced garlic and ‌cook ⁤for 1⁣ minute⁢ until aromatic; avoid‌ burning.
  3. Add ground turkey ​in a ⁢single layer,⁤ breaking it apart with ‍a wooden ⁣spoon. Cook until browned and no longer pink, about 7-8 minutes. Brown in batches if your pan is overcrowded to ensure caramelization.
  4. Mix in tomato paste, dried oregano, ‍and basil. Cook for 2 minutes, stirring, ⁢to develop⁤ deeper flavor.
  5. Pour in crushed ​tomatoes and⁤ broth. Bring to a simmer, ‍then reduce ⁣heat to low. Cover loosely ⁣and let the sauce gently bubble for ⁢15 ‍minutes to⁣ concentrate flavors.
  6. Meanwhile, prepare zucchini ribbons using a ​spiralizer or vegetable ⁢peeler. Pat dry ‌with paper towels to remove excess moisture, preventing sogginess.
  7. In a seperate pan, heat remaining 1 tbsp olive oil over‍ medium‌ heat. Sauté ‌zucchini ribbons for 2-3 ‌minutes ​until just tender ⁤but still ‍retaining bite.Season⁤ lightly ⁢with salt and pepper. Avoid overcooking to maintain texture.
  8. Season⁤ the sauce ⁣with ‍salt, pepper,​ and red pepper flakes (if ‍using). ‍Stir in⁣ fresh torn basil leaves just before serving to maximize freshness.
  9. Serve turkey bolognese‌ sauce over zucchini ribbons, garnished with‌ a sprinkle⁤ of grated Parmesan and extra basil.

Creative ⁤Tips ​for Enhancing the Sauce with Fresh Herbs and ‍Spices

  • Try adding a ‍splash⁢ of red wine during⁢ the simmering ‌step​ to deepen the sauce’s ⁤complexity.
  • Fresh rosemary or thyme make excellent additions alongside basil for a woodsy twist.
  • Incorporate ground‍ fennel seeds ⁣ for subtle anise notes reminiscent of traditional ⁤Italian sausage.
  • Finish with​ a splash of ​quality balsamic vinegar ⁢ just before serving to elevate brightness and ⁣balance acidity.
  • For a touch of⁣ creaminess, ⁣swirl in a dollop of plain Greek ⁢yogurt or ⁣ricotta cheese on ‍the side.

Chef’s⁤ Notes

  • Make it vegetarian: Swap ground turkey for lentils or crumbled ​tempeh​ for a plant-based ​version ‌bursting with protein.
  • Advance prep: The ‍sauce ⁣tastes even better the next⁣ day and​ freezes beautifully ‍for up⁢ to 3 months.
  • Prevent watery ​zucchini: Salt zucchini ribbons lightly and ‍drain excess moisture ‍before sautéing​ to keep the sauce rich and thick.
  • Adjust heat: Control spice level by⁢ varying red pepper ⁣flakes or ⁢adding a dash of ​smoked paprika for a ⁤smoky edge.
  • Use low-sodium broth: ⁤Keeping salt in ​check allows ⁤herbs and fresh ingredients ⁢to shine through.
